ok, so i am going to enlist in the air force. my ultimate goal is to become a pilot. i have one year of college under my belt and i have no intention on continuing school further (until after i enlist of course, so i can be an officer) due to financial reasons.

so what job would be a good one for me as an enlistee wanting to be a pilot. are there certain enlisted jobs for me that can potentially give me some useful experience that would translate into a higher chance of getting a pilot slot later? and are there certain majors that would also translate into a higher chance? i know technical majors like engineering look good on your resume, but is there a certain one that will benefit me most?

deganajo, please know that ALL pilots in the USAF are commissioned Officers as well. That means at least 4 year degree, complete ROTC, or AFAcad. or OCS, US citizen, passing flight physical etc. Can you handle all that? There is no enlisted job in the USAF that substantially increases your chances to become a pilot. Enlisted Aircraft specific technical jobs (such as Jet Engine-ejection seat mechanic etc.) help you understand your job as pilot better (should you become one).

If you want to enlist and continue your schooling through the military the one job that would help you understand a pilots job would be air traffic control. Im not trying to hype on my own job but as ATC we control every apsect of flight for an aircraft. ATC wouldnt help you understand the equipment but it would help you see how the skys work. But like tanker said, its no small task to commision as a pilot.
